Output dbd7970cd9b61a14376cad6f1cd95b76c8e619cca6383e1657cf153f4a2b87b0:13

value
5018564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 301a14f4e2f7f2bbc86be2f49730f63bb0878068 OP_EQUAL
address
365Mbx7s7dQXHqDbBU8a88wNrPmx9uqoeu
transaction
dbd7970cd9b61a14376cad6f1cd95b76c8e619cca6383e1657cf153f4a2b87b0
confirmations
234683
spent
true